Types and Characteristics of Aluminum Gear

Types and Characteristics of Aluminum Gear

Aluminum gear can be classified into different types based on their design and application. Some of the common types of aluminum gear include:

  • Spur gear
  • Spur gear has straight teeth and is suitable for low-speed, high-torque applications.

  • Helical gear
  • Helical gear has angled teeth that run smoothly and quietly, making it ideal for high-speed applications.

  • Bevel gear
  • Bevel gear has angled teeth that allow it to transmit power between shafts that meet at an angle.

  • Rack and pinion gear
  • Rack and pinion gear is used to convert rotational motion into linear motion.
